  • Free to Use
    Wick Editor is completely free and open-source, making it accessible for users without budget constraints.
  • Web-Based
    Since Wick Editor operates in the browser, there's no need for software installation, and it's available on any device with internet access.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The platform features an intuitive and clean interface, which is ideal for beginners and those who are new to animation and interactive project creation.
  • Multifunctional
    Wick Editor supports both vector-based animation and scripting, allowing users to create a wide variety of multimedia projects.
  • Active Community
    Wick Editor has an active and supportive community, providing tutorials, forums, and additional resources for new users.

Possible disadvantages

  • Performance Limitations
    Being a browser-based tool, Wick Editor can experience performance issues, especially with more complex or resource-intensive projects.
  • Limited Advanced Features
    Compared to professional-grade software like Adobe Animate, Wick Editor may lack some advanced features required for more sophisticated animations.
  • Less Industry Adoption
    Wick Editor is not as widely adopted in the industry, which may limit collaboration opportunities and integration with other professional tools.
  • Internet Dependency
    Since it is web-based, functioning without an internet connection is not possible, which can be restrictive for some users.
  • Learning Curve for Scripting
    While the interface is user-friendly, the scripting aspect might still present a learning curve for users with no prior coding experience.
  • Cloud-Based
    CodeTasty is cloud-based, allowing you to access your projects from anywhere with an internet connection, which promotes flexibility and remote collaboration.
  • Collaborative Features
    CodeTasty offers real-time collaboration features enabling multiple users to work on the same project simultaneously, which is beneficial for team projects.
  • Wide Language Support
    The platform supports multiple programming languages, making it versatile for developers working with diverse coding needs.
  • Easy Setup
    There's no need to install software locally, which simplifies the setup process and saves time for developers.
  • In-Browser Coding
    Allows users to code directly in the browser without the need for local machine resources, enhancing accessibility and convenience.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Offline Access
    As a cloud-based IDE, it requires an internet connection to function, which can be a limitation in environments with unreliable connectivity.
  • Performance Constraints
    Depending on internet speed and browser capability, the performance may not be as high as traditional locally installed IDEs, potentially affecting efficiency.
  • Subscription Costs
    While offering a free tier, advanced features may be behind a paywall, which can be a barrier for some users or small teams with limited budgets.
  • Security Concerns
    Storing and editing code in the cloud increases the risk of potential data breaches, making security a critical consideration.
  • Dependency on Browser
    Functionality and experience might vary depending on the browser used, leading to inconsistent user experiences.
